Bilateral emphysematous pyelonephritis in autosomal dominant polycystic kidney disease
Emphysematous pyelonephritis (EPN) is an uncommon infection of renal parenchyma with gas-forming organisms. EPN is usually seen in patients with diabetes mellitus (DM).
